Board of Advisors to Trustees and Administration
The Board of Advisors is constituted of women and men who have given years of service and support to the College and who wish to remain actively engaged in its affairs. An exclusively consultative body, the advisory board is made up primarily of former trustees and others who, in the judgment of the Trusteeship Committee of the Board of Trustees, have demonstrated significant investment in the mission of Holy Cross and can offer valuable advice and counsel. Numbering approximately 80 members, the Board of Advisors assists the President and Board of Trustees with consultation and recommendations based in their knowledge, expertise and professional experience, all of which contributes to the advancement of the College’s mission and goals. The Board of Advisors meets as needed in order to discuss salient issues and exchange opinions with College executive leadership.
